Practical Seller Notes Before Listing
Before publishing any product using For the Love of the Game Basketball SVG, I recommend running through a few quick tests:
- Test on real mockups – Use platforms like Placeit or Canva to see how it looks on actual products like mugs, shirts, or wall art.
- Preview as a thumbnail – Make sure it’s visually strong even at small sizes.
- Check PNG transparency – Confirm there are no hidden background pixels that could cause issues in layered designs.
- Verify SVG cut quality – If you’re using this for Cricut or Silhouette projects, test the cut lines in your machine’s software.
- Confirm commercial licensing – Always double-check the license terms before selling any product that uses third-party design assets.
- Pair with appropriate fonts – I found it worked best with bold sans-serif fonts for a modern sports look, but also paired well with clean script fonts for a more playful twist.
